Output 93073768bd6216f0a96b044f0a9d4edfab6b453497c62bdb8a9c21e7cc256aba:47

value
105650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 182b110913ddd2939dfa101d15d27509b488664b OP_EQUAL
address
33tojTr3o5vnNjdvCCpQMWqkQJwQEfC5c6
transaction
93073768bd6216f0a96b044f0a9d4edfab6b453497c62bdb8a9c21e7cc256aba
spent
true